Effects

There are a number of effects that i have included in the editing phase. There are examples listed below:

The 'Blur'



The blur has been added to give two impressions. Firstly, the main character is just waking up so I needed to create a dazed feel to his vision. Secondly, I wanted to keep a psychological atmosphere to the footage so the blur gives a hazy though process, doesn't have a clear vision into the future.

The CCTV Camera


I gave this footage a fuzzy feel as if it was actually being recorded and gave it a roll at the bottom of the screen to also show this effect. The 'REC' was added as it shows that its from a camera of some sort. I feel that i have achieved this CCTV feel to the footage.
